    U.S. Marine Corps Cpl. Carlos Orjuela, a loadmaster with Marine Aerial Refueler Transport Squadron (VMGR) 152, Marine Aircraft Group 12, 1st Marine Aircraft Wing, adjusts a cable for paratroopers on a KC-130J Super Hercules aircraft during exercise Evergreen 26 at Joint Base Lewis-McChord, Washington, Aug. 10, 2026. Exercise Evergreen 26 provided VMGR-152 the opportunity to enhance combat readiness and aircrew proficiency through joint training with U.S. Marine Corps, U.S. Army and U.S. Air Force units. Orjuela is a native of California. (U.S. Marine Corps photo by Cpl. Cecilia Campbell)
